WOMEN’S STATISTICS
Though long considered a niche market, U.S. women in fact constitute the number three market in the world, with their collective buying power exceeding the economy of Japan
- Women account for $7 trillion in consumer and business spending
- Women control more than 60 percent of all personal wealth in the U.S.
- Women comprise 51.4 percent of the U.S. population, and make or influence 85 percent of all purchasing decisions
- Women are starting their own businesses at twice the rate of men
- Women make 80 percent of healthcare decisions and 68 percent of new car purchase decisions
- In 31 percent of the marriages where women work, women now out-earn their husbands
- One out of every 11 American women owns a business (U.S. Dept. of Labor)
- Women purchase over 50 percent of traditional male products, including automobiles, home improvement products and consumer electronics
- Women account for 58 percent of all total online spending
